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Black Duiker | Booted Warbler |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order | Artiodactyla (Even-toed Ungulates) | Passeriformes (Songbirds) |
| Family | Bovidae (Bovids) | Acrocephalidae |
| Genus | Cephalophus | Iduna |
| Species | Cephalophus niger | Iduna caligata |
Evolutionary Relationship
Black Duiker and Booted Warbler share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
